Introduction Pachymetry (Greek words: Pachos = thick + metry = to measure) is term used for the measurement of corneal thickness. It is an important indicator of health status of the cornea especially of corneal endothelial pump function The thickness of the cornea was … WebFor ultrasound pachymetry vs. OCT pachymetry, r 2 =0.93 and P<0.0001. For ultrasound pachymetry vs. specular microscopy, r 2 =0.88 and P<0.0001. For OCT pachymetry vs. specular microscopy, r 2 =0.98 and P<0.0001. In conclusion, OCT pachymetry, specular microscopy, and ultrasound pachymetry can be used in clinical settings to measure CCT.

Web2 de jun. de 2024 · Thin corneas are when the thickness falls below 500 microns (half a millimeter) since the average normal thickness of a cornea is about 540 microns. How …
